"We called the plumber because the toliets were stopped up. When he came out, there was one problem after another. Apparently the pipes in the bathrooms were cast iron and had completely rusted out. They had to jackhammer the concrete in both bathrooms to replace the pipes up to where the pipes were good. They found mold when they remove the tile in the bathrooms, so they had to deal with that. When installing the overflow valve in the front of the house they found that the sewer pipes were made out of clay and had tree roots in them. They had to dig a trench from the house out to the sidewalk and replace those sewer lines and cut down one of my trees. They also replaced the washing machine hookup and some other things. After it was done, they retiled and repainted the bathrooms. The job took about a week, which was less time that Alex, the plumber, had estimated.
,
I would give everything an A or B, except they left rock and clay pipe fragments in my front yard where they dug the trench. All other debris was cleaned up. Some of the tile in the half-bath is not quite level and the paint around the base boards is not good. The prior baseboard was 3" vinyl, which they replaced with standard 1" wood. That was ok, but they didn't remove the adhesive from the wall where the vinyl baseboard was, so the paint is all lumpy there. Also, the door on the main bath is not quite right. It's functional, but it has a little hitch when you open it all the way.
I'm mostly satisfied. I'm not sure about the price. I don't know the going rate for this situation. $17,160.00 is a lot of money, but they did a lot of work. I kind of wish I had asked for a second opinion, just so I'd be sure that it was a fair price, but I don't really feel like I was ripped off.
